Norfolk Southern releases 2026 Forging a Better Tomorrow report

Forging a Better Tomorrow report 2026 cover page

Norfolk Southern has released its 2026 Forging a Better Tomorrow report, highlighting progress in building a safer, stronger, and more sustainable railroad. Covering performance from 2025 through early 2026, the annual report showcases how continued investment and innovation are helping deliver for customers, strengthen communities, and support long-term growth.

 

Driving business excellence and innovation

We’re investing in infrastructure, technology, and AI-powered solutions that strengthen performance, improve service reliability, and create long-term value for our customers.

  • Invested more than $1 billion in infrastructure upgrades to improve safety, capacity, and service
  • Supported 60+ industrial development projects, generating $7.7 billion in investment activity
  • Expanded AI-powered inspection, monitoring, and analytics to improve safety and network performance
  • Announced an agreement with Union Pacific to create America's first transcontinental railroad, connecting more than 50,000 route miles across 43 states

 

Building a better planet

Our commitment to sustainability is embedded in our day-to-day decisions, helping us move what matters while building a lower-carbon, more resilient future.

  • Achieved a record 5% improvement in locomotive fuel efficiency and surpassed 1,000 DC-to-AC locomotive modernizations
  • Diverted 84% of operational waste from landfills while generating a record $101 million through resource recovery
  • Expanded RailGreen and reporting tools to help customers reduce supply chain emissions

 

Advancing a culture of safety

Safety is a core value that guides every decision we make. We strengthen our safety culture through accountability, continuous improvement, investments in advanced technologies, and ongoing training.

  • Achieved the best FRA-reportable train accident rate in more than a decade, a 29% improvement compared with 2024, and reduced the employee injury rate by 15%
  • Trained more than 5,800 first responders through our Operation Awareness & Response program
  • More than 75% of traffic was scanned monthly by Digital Train Inspection portals

 

Strengthening communities and our workforce

People are the power behind Norfolk Southern. We invest in our railroaders while supporting the communities where we live and work through charitable giving, volunteerism, workforce development, and strategic partnerships.

  • Contributed more than $18.2 million to charitable organizations for the third consecutive year
  • Railroaders volunteered more than 7,200 hours in communities across our network
  • Strengthened partnerships with craft employees and labor organizations, ratifying agreements with all 13 unions
